so just as an illustration of how 1 judge can swing things

Prelims visual analysis judge had Cadets behind BD (who was in 2nd) by 0.2

tonight's visual analysis judge (the lovely ex-27th member Debbie Torchia) had the Cadets behind BD (who were now in 1st) in visual analysis by 1.7pts

that's a swing of 1.5 points OVERNIGHT / and made a 0.75 difference in the final scores

this aligns closely with her history as a judge

as does George O's scoring

Guard

Thursday night Crown took guard over BD by 0.2 pts

Friday night with George O scoring, BD was over Crown by 0.1pts - again, closely following his judging history

So not as big a swing there - but still a 0.3 difference, amounting to .15 in final score

As for captions:

GE: Crown mostly has this locked up.

Vis: Blue Devils have this locked up.

Guard: Crown has a 0.1 point lead on BD.

Music: Cadets has it locked up.

Brass: Tie with Cadets and Crown. The higher score wins it in finals.

Percussion: Tie with Cadets and SCV with BD 0.05 behind. Basically winner at finals gets it.
